Revolutionizing Movement and Construction

The core functionality of this mod is designed to replicate the high-level technique known as "speedbridging" or "ninja bridging," but with perfect consistency. Once activated, the modification detects your position on the edge of a platform and begins placing blocks beneath your feet as you retreat. What sets this apart from simple macros is the level of control it offers. Users can choose between three distinct bridging speeds: slow, normal, and fast. This flexibility ensures that you can adapt to different server rules or personal playstyles, making it a versatile addition to any modded client.

Mastering the Command System

Interaction with the mod is handled through a robust command-line interface, ensuring that users have granular control over its functions. All commands are prefixed with /asb, standing for Auto Speedbridge. To begin constructing, you simply position yourself at the edge of a block and type /asb startBridging. The system will immediately take over, placing blocks as you walk backward. If you need to halt the process instantly, perhaps due to an obstacle or an enemy player, the /asb stopBridging command ceases all activity immediately.

Customization extends to the velocity of your construction. By entering /asb bridgeSpeed fast, normal, or slow, you can dictate the pace of block placement. The default setting is usually normal, which offers a balance between speed and resource consumption. Furthermore, the mod supports hotkey binding for seamless gameplay. Using /asb hotkey record allows you to assign a specific key on your keyboard to toggle the bridging function on and off without typing commands repeatedly. If you wish to remove this binding, the /asb hotkey delete command clears the current configuration.

Tips for Effective Usage

While the mod handles the mechanics of block placement, strategic usage is still required for optimal results. Always ensure you have a sufficient stack of blocks in your main hand before initiating the sequence. Running out of materials mid-bridge while moving backward can result in a sudden drop. Additionally, practice using the hotkey toggle in safe environments before relying on it in competitive scenarios. Understanding the delay between pressing the key and the mod activating can save you from awkward situations during intense gameplay moments.
